Formica redheaded sent on April 14, 2016 (19:06) by Jazzbozz. 12 comments, 1261 views. [retina]

, 1/250 f/9.0, ISO 100, hand held.

Scatto singolo, Obiettivo invertito montato su 90 mm di tubi di prolunga + crop compositivo. La PDC è veramente esigua, non è eccellente come immagine ma ho voluto postarla comunque perché riuscire a beccare una formica viva, che non sta ferma un attimo, è stata una soddisfazione fantastica!
